Being in Japan has given me some new impetus to carry on with this. Although the flats are just about ready to be put in the catalogue (just building up a bit of stock first) I thought a need for some street furniture, in the form of a power line and some pavements.

The pavements need some extra work on them and I'm as of yet undecided which route to follow.

The power line I'm happy with and I think I'm going to make a castable version as making many of these makes me shudder  lol

For the demo board they will have cables strung between them and they will be based on clear bases.





The aircon units have had to be done again as I wasn't happy with them and I've got an idea for some modular ducting but more on that when it's done  :)
